Macau Black Knights Outgun Titan Ultra Giant Risers in High-Scoring Commissioner Cup Clash

In a fast-paced, high-octane affair, the Macau Black Knights secured a decisive 119-107 victory over the Titan Ultra Giant Risers in the Philippine Basketball Commissioner Cup. The match, played on April 21, 2026, saw the Black Knights' offense fire on all cylinders, overpowering the Risers in a contest defined by scoring runs and offensive efficiency.

Match Overview: Offensive Firepower on Display

From the opening tip, the game was played at a breakneck pace. The Macau Black Knights established their intent early, leveraging a potent inside-out attack to build a lead. While the Titan Ultra Giant Risers showcased their own offensive capabilities, consistently putting points on the board, they struggled to contain the Knights' multifaceted scoring threats. The final 12-point margin, 119-107, reflects a game where both teams found offensive rhythm, but the Black Knights maintained superior control and execution throughout the four quarters.
